The usual: B6277 from Middleton-in-Teesdale to Alston (worth a stop), then A686 to Hartside (just to say you've done it :) ) & Penrith; A689 from Alston to A68 then...

...the back roads: A689 to Eastgate (give me a wave as you pass, or my local, the Cross Keys does B&B and I'll see you for a beer) then up the fell to Rookhope, Allenheads, Allendale, Hexham (Wentworth Cafe worth a stop). When you get to the A69, a few places worth a visit: Hexham, Corbridge, Roman forts on Hadrian's Wall at Chesters, Housteads, Birdoswald.

Back down via A68, then A6278 to Stanhope, Eggleston, Barnard Castle (worth a stop).

Other nice runs, B6276 from Middleton-in-Teesdale to Brough; A686 Haydon Bridge to Alston; Penrith to Brampton on the B6412/6413; from Stanhope up Crawleyside Bank (B6278), turn left at the top along Meadow's Edge to Blanchland then B6306 to Hexham.

Dent to Hawes first, then up and over Buttertubs down to Thwaite, north west over to Nateby then up to Brough, Middleton on/in Teesdale, then coOkie's suggestions. Empty roads everywhere and to me even better than the Dales for riding.:thumby:
